Steps to Put Mac on DND
Step 1: Click on the Notification Center Icon
The first step towards putting your Mac on DND mode is by clicking on the Notification Center icon that is located on the top-right corner of your screen. Alternatively, you can also swipe left using two fingers from the right edge of your trackpad to open the Notification Center.
Step 2: Scroll Up in the Notification Center
Once you open the Notification Center, you need to scroll upwards to access the Do Not Disturb option.
Step 3: Turn on DND for a Specific Time
If you want to turn on DND mode for a specific time, click on the option and select the desired time duration. This will mute all the incoming notifications on your Mac for the selected time duration.
Step 4: Turn on DND for the Entire Day
If you want to turn on DND mode for the entire day, click on the option that says “Until Tomorrow.” This will mute all the incoming notifications on your Mac for the day.
Step 5: Access DND Settings
To access the DND settings on your Mac, click on the Apple icon on the top-left corner of your screen. Select the “System Preferences” option from the drop-down menu.
Step 6: Click on the “Notifications” Option
Once you are in the System Preferences menu, click on the “Notifications” option under the “Personal” category.
Step 7: Click on the “Do Not Disturb” Option
In the Notifications menu, select the “Do Not Disturb” option from the left sidebar.
Step 8: Toggle on the “Turn on Do Not Disturb” Option
To turn on DND mode for your Mac, toggle on the “Turn on Do Not Disturb” option.
Step 9: Customize DND Settings
You can customize your DND settings according to your preference by selecting the day, time, and other options provided.
Step 10: Allow Calls from Selected Contacts Only
If you want to allow calls from only selected contacts during DND mode, click on the “Allow Calls From” option and select the desired contacts.
Step 11: Hide Notifications on the Lock Screen
You can also choose to hide notifications on the lock screen during DND mode by toggling on the “Turn off notifications on lock screen” option.
Step 12: Schedule DND Mode
Finally, you can schedule DND mode to turn on and off automatically according to your daily routine by selecting the “Schedule” option and entering the desired time duration.

1. What is DND?
DND stands for Do Not Disturb, a feature available on most devices that blocks incoming calls, notifications, and alerts from disturbing your activity.
2. Why would I want to put my Mac on DND?
You may want to put your Mac on DND to avoid distractions while working, studying, or sleeping. It can also be helpful during presentations or meetings.
3. How do I access DND on my Mac?
To access DND on your Mac, click on the notification center icon on the top right corner of your screen, and then click on the moon icon to turn it on. You can also customize DND settings in the notification center preferences.
4. Can I schedule DND on my Mac?
Yes, you can schedule DND on your Mac to turn on and off at specific times by going to System Preferences > Notifications > Do Not Disturb and choosing the “From” and “To” times.
5. Will DND affect my alarms and timers?
No, DND will not affect alarms or timers on your Mac, they will still go off as scheduled.
6. Can I allow calls from specific contacts while on DND?
Yes, you can allow calls from specific contacts while on DND by going to System Preferences > Notifications > Do Not Disturb and selecting the option to allow calls from selected contacts.
7. How do I turn off DND on my Mac?
To turn off DND on your Mac, simply click on the notification center icon and click on the moon icon again to turn it off.
8. Can I customize DND on my Mac?
Yes, you can customize DND on your Mac by going to System Preferences > Notifications > Do Not Disturb and choosing the options that work best for you.
